Network science in creativity research

Yoed N. Kennett

Network science is based on mathematical graph theory, offering a multidisciplinary quantitative approach to represent complex systems as networks. Over the past two decades, it has been increasingly applied in creativity research, across cognitive, personality, psychometric, and neural domains. This workshop will provide an introduction, basic network tools, and hands-on experience on network analysis in creativity research, for anyone interested in such multidisciplinary creativity research.


Art Museum Experiences for Connection and Transformation: A (Playful) Workshop on Mapping Impact, Aligning Outcomes, and Designing Interventions

Aleksandra Sherman & Aleksandra Igdalova

Explore how activity-based art experiences can foster engagement, creativity, transformation, and connection. In this play-inspired, hands-on workshop, psychologists and museum professionals will co-design creative interventions, reflect on shared outcomes, and consider how these can be meaningfully studied and applied in real-world museum contexts, with shared visual and written outputs.
